Brand Manager#26-00643
Stamford, CT
All On-site
Job Description
Responsibilities:
Developing and executing annual and long-term strategic plans for the brand and consistent with corporate priorities
Actively managing brand P&L
Leading and influencing innovation to develop and execute short and long-term core improvement and new products.
Building consumer awareness, generate trial, increase distribution and drive sales by developing effective consumer promotions and communications plans. Quantifying and evaluating effectiveness by directing post-program analysis.
Partnering with internal departments to develop trade, retail, and category strategies to meet consumer and customer objectives.
Championing brand with cross-functional teams to gain alignment on Brand Plans and drive execution excellence
Managing all marketing activities including but not limited to promotions, research, packaging and pricing
Developing and maintain relationships with external partners and agencies
Developing and consistently building the brand equity as a means of attaining volume goals and long-term profit growth
Evaluating performance, identify competitive threats, and determine product strengths, weaknesses and opportunities by conducting market analyses
Executing marketing strategy, plans, and tactics.
Requirements:
5+ years experience in consumer products marketing and/or sales.
Strong interpersonal/communication skills; solid analytical skills; strong financial orientation
Demonstrated ability to manage multiple complex or fast-moving projects
Ability to analyze research data and make decisions designed to generate incremental sales and profits
Knowledge of wide variety of specific promotion vehicles and vendors
Demonstrated leadership and organization skills required
Demonstrated ability to manage a team of 1-2 people
Proficiency with Excel, Powerpoint, Word and IRI/Nielsen
Education:
BS/BA (Business, Social Sciences - Psychology, Sociology, Economics)
MBA preferred
